Sammy Suggestion: Disney Gallery: The Mandalorian (Anytime / Disney Plus)
Earlier this year many people were shocked to learn Disney Plus’ breakthrough hit The Mandalorian was shot entirely indoors. Even when they were “outside.” So to understand how all this Industrial Light and Magic happened Disney Plus is offering us this weekly 8 episode docu-series. “We had a great experience making the show and we’re looking forward to sharing it with you,” says executive producer Jon Favreau. He’ll be your “Happy” host taking you on a tour of this world with interviews, models and effects and creatures (always with the creatures) and leading roundtable conversations (hopefully those are compelling. They can sometimes veer into pretentiousness.) (Also The Mandalorian’s second season was expected to be released in October however that seems likely due to current circumstances so enjoy this show sloooowly.)

Sammy Suggestion: Spaceship Earth (Anytime / Hulu)
Oh I so wanna see this. Every now and then we’ll run into a documentary and go: how do people live like this? None of us fully appreciate or grasp just what’s out there and how not everyone lives and works the “exact” same way. “Spaceship Earth is the true, stranger-than-fiction, adventure of eight visionaries who in 1991 spent two years quarantined inside of a self-engineered replica of Earth’s ecosystem called BIOSPHERE 2.” Was this science or science fiction? Only one way to find out.

Sammy Suggestion: Into The Night (Anytime / Netflix)
As I wrap up Amazon Prime’s Tales from the Loop (why are you not watching this sci-fi tv show! It is so not gonna get renewed for Season 2. Thanks for nothing nerds!!) Into The Night is my new sci-fi series. It is outstanding and highly recommended. People are on the run…from the sun. Yo!! Human-Vampires?! What’s happening? It’s Netflix’s first Belgian original series (based on the Polish science fiction novel The Old Axolotl by Jacek Dukaj). I don’t have any references for any of those things. Into The Night (terrible title…hope that’s just a poor translation) came out on Netflix on May 1st. 6 episodes 35 minutes each. Excellent short and sweet weekend viewing. On The Run…From The Sun!
